How different is the M21F compared to the M21B when it comes to flood/throw? GT- FC40 emitter.

Should be very similar. M21F has a slightly larger reflector (about 2mm larger in depth & diameter) so it will produce a slightly narrower beam.

Simon, thank you for all your incredible work and making Convoy flashlights possible. I just received my latest order with two more C8+’s to complete the set. These are tremendously fun lights.

For anyone wondering (left to right)
• Osram W1 White
• Luminus SFT40 6500K
• Osramber^TM (with 8x7135 driver)
• Osram W1 Red
• 365NM UV (with ZWB2 filter & buck driver)
• Osram W1 Blue
• Osram W1 Green
• Nichia 519A 4500K (dedomed)

Every one of these has had a forward clicky switch and FW3A clip installed (silver, orange, and black bodies required some modification but the rest worked with zero adjustment). I’ve also installed body-color switch boots where possible. Soon I’ll be installing magnetic tailcaps on all of them as well so they can be used with their diffusers as hanging lanterns.

Simon, I ran into an quality issue with the triple mcpcb (the TIR combo). There are some very sharp edges right where the wires go. It was easily fixed for a single board by filing the edges by hand. But it’s probably not good if this ends up in mass production, since this might cut the wire insulation and cause a potential short.
